We were passing through and staying overnight in Atlanta so my wife looked up places to eat and this restaurant popped up. It had great reviews so we tried it. The food was good. Depending on what you ordered , as far as meat goes, it was cook right then and there. Food was well seasoned. When ordering it is like an assembly line. The employees were friendly. Only complaint is that they messed up on our order somehow. So the person in front of us got my sides and I got there sides. To my recollection there is no dine in available at this restaurant. But overall it was good.

It smelled like home when I walked in. The servers are out going, respectful, and fun. The greens tasty just like I would cook them, yams were flavored well and not too sweet; just right. Rosemary chicken was flavorful and not dry. Highly recommend!
